Remove the Boursin Cheese from the fridge and set aside to let warm up to room temperature a bit.
Preheat the oven to 375F and line a small baking sheet or baking dish with parchment paper.
Prepare the dates, if not pitted use a small sharp knife to make a slit lengthwise on one side of the date (do not slice all the way through) and remove the pits.
Open the dates and stuff each date with 1 1/2 tsp of the Boursin Cheese and place each stuffed date on the parchment lined baking sheet (or in the baking dish).
In a small bowl mix together the finely chopped salted pistachios, olive oil, orange zest and honey. Spoon the pistachio mixture over the stuffed dates, making sure the top of each date get a big of the mixture.
Bake the dates for 12 minutes and then remove from the oven. Let the dates sit for 5 minutes before moving to a serving tray and garnish with minced fresh rosemary and pomegranate seeds. Serve immediately and enjoy!
